Port of Loviisa LTD

Port of Loviisa Ltd is co-owned by Port of Helsinki Ltd (60%) and the City of Loviisa (40%).

The port started operating as a limited company on 1 September 2014. The port remained a fully-owned subsidiary of the City of Loviisa until Port of Helsinki Ltd acquired majority ownership of 60% in the company as of the start of 2017.

As a result of the change in ownership, Loviisa received more resources for developing its operations, while the Port of Helsinki gained the opportunity to expand its operations beyond passenger and unitized cargo services. The arrangement strengthens the Port of Loviisa’s position and allows it to meet the diverse transportation needs of its customers even better than before.

Agile and competent port

The Port of Loviisa is a service centre specialising in industrial cargo, a so-called full service port, where the needs of each customer are considered individually. Our values are responsibility, cooperation and productivity and we create possibilities for adaptable, responsible and productive port operations.

We are a small port and cargo traffic hub located right next to Helsinki, only a short distance away from the area of consumption and export industry of southern Finland.

Loviisa has great road and rail connections to everywhere in Finland. We can serve customers as a distribution centre for road traffic and as a distribution hub for coastal traffic. We are located only a short fairway away from the shipping routes of the Gulf of Finland, due to which the vessels visiting our port save time and money in pilotage fees, for example.

Excellent transport connections:

  • 7 minutes from motorway E18
  • Train connection via Lahti
  • Short and deep fairway, draught 9.5 m
